| 0:12.7 | Hey, film spotters. |
| 0:14.0 | We're digging deep into the archive. |
| 0:16.3 | Going way back to episode 419, Michael Phillips joined us for a sacred cow conversation about Stanley Kubrick's The Shining, which is 45 this year. |
| 0:28.5 | And we thought it was only fitting because we're talking about Zach Crager's weapons, a huge influence on Crager as a filmmaker. If you Google his name, Josh, you will find Kubrick |
| 0:41.2 | in The Shining mentioned almost in any conversation that this filmmaker has. And of course, |
| 0:46.0 | when you watch the film, you know that that time 217 comes up again and again. And I thought, |
| 0:54.0 | well, is that the, is that the room and the shining? |
| 0:57.3 | There has to be some relevance, right? |
| 0:59.1 | And then I remembered, wait, no. |
| 1:01.6 | Maybe it's just random because the room is 237. |
| 1:06.3 | Well, I did a little bit more digging. |
| 1:09.4 | 217 is the book, the Stephen King book, The Shining. |
| 1:13.4 | Turns out 217 is the room there. |
| 1:16.6 | Craig are trying to prove he smarter than all of us with that one. |
| 1:19.9 | Yeah, we didn't play a ton of spot the reference in our review of weapons. |
| 1:24.3 | We named checked a movie or two, but definitely the shining is in that mix. |
| 1:28.3 | And yeah, never a bad time to talk about the shining. |
